**Protected Health Information (PHI)** is individually identifiable health information that is transmitted or maintained in any form.
18 HIPAA Identifiers:
1. Names
2. Geographic data (smaller than state)
3. Dates (except year) related to an individual
4. Phone numbers
5. Fax numbers
6. Email addresses
7. Social Security numbers
8. Medical record numbers
9. Health plan beneficiary numbers
10. Account numbers
11. Certificate/license numbers
12. Vehicle identifiers and serial numbers
13. Device identifiers and serial numbers
14. Web URLs
15. IP addresses
16. Biometric identifiers
17. Full-face photos
18. Any other unique identifying number or code
ePHI (Electronic PHI):
PHI that is created, received, maintained, or transmitted electronically. This includes:

Health information with all 18 identifiers removed (Safe Harbor) or certified by an expert (Expert Determination) is not considered PHI and is not protected by HIPAA.
